Transaction efe16652acca89bb7963e275321fa1641725251167a7ec57b035206b6acf0656
1 Input
1 Output
-
efe16652acca89bb7963e275321fa1641725251167a7ec57b035206b6acf0656:0
- value
- 373928
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3cafc9dc4173263cfbaec593297d3285bdbeeb2
- address
- bc1q5090e8wyzuex8na6a3vn997n9pdahm4jxqvjs9